Abstract:

A (3+2)-cycloaddition of N-amino quinolinium salts with in situ generated trifluoroacetonitrile is disclosed. The reaction affords access to structurally diverse 2-(trifluoromethyl)-[1,2,4]triazolo[1,5-a]quinoline derivatives in good yields, utilizing 2,2,2-trifluoroacetaldehyde O-(aryl)oxime as precursor of trifluoroacetonitrile.
